About Giant
There are two bands that go by the name of Giant.
Giant is an American aor/hard rock band that was formed in 1987 by brothers Dann and David Huff. The band had one hit single with its power ballad I'll See You in My Dreams. They disbanded in the early 90's after two studio albums. Dann Huff revived the Giant name in 2001 with the album entitled, "III". Dann is a high-demand session player and producer in Nashville who has worked with many artists from Faith Hill to Megadeth.
The other band is an experimental doom metal band in the vein of Isis, Pelican and Neurosis hailing from North Carolina. They have released a EP (Song) as well as a split with past tour mates Tides. Giant blend innovative instrumentation, including strings and organ, with their heavy, towering, yet melodic sound. They uphold strong anti-capitalist, vegan, straightedge ideals, and both intellectual and deeply passionate elements can found in their music and lyrics. Giant has released music through Southern Empire records and Level Plane and recently signed to The End records.
